예제 #1
0
        public async Task OnCancelProperty()
        {
            PropertyGridVm.CleanSourceCache();
            ShowPropertyGrid = false;

            await OnOpenWizzard(SelectedItem);
        }
예제 #2
0
        public async Task OnOkProperty()
        {
            PropertyGridVm.CleanSourceCache();
            IsShowProperty = false;

            await SaveChanges();
        }
        public override void ShowPropertyGrid(string tagonomyId)
        {
            PropertyGridVm.CleanSourceCache();

            Selected = _allTagonomies.FirstOrDefault(it => it.Id == tagonomyId);

            IsShowProperty = true;
        }
예제 #4
0
        public async Task OnOkProperty()
        {
            PropertyGridVm.CleanSourceCache();
            IsShowProperty = false;

            await SaveChangesAsync();

            await LoadThemeList();
        }
예제 #5
0
        public override void ShowPropertyGrid(string nodeConfigId)
        {
            // load node configuration
            PropertyGridVm.CleanSourceCache();

            var nodeConfiguration = Source.Nodes.FirstOrDefault(it => it.Id == nodeConfigId);

            SelectedNode = (HyperWorkflowNodeData)nodeConfiguration.CreateNodeInstance(true);

            IsShowProperty = true;
        }
 public void OnCancelProperty()
 {
     PropertyGridVm.CleanSourceCache();
     IsShowProperty = false;
 }
예제 #7
0
 public Task <object> LoadPropertyGrid()
 {
     PropertyGridVm.CleanSourceCache();
     return(Task.FromResult <object>(SelectedPhase));
 }